代码之家  ›  专栏  ›  技术社区  ›  louism

低价项目(预算紧张)-有什么特点?[关闭]

  •  1
  • louism  · 技术社区  · 15 年前

    我正在尝试确定一些标记,这些标记表示资源有限的项目。

    根据我的经验,一个项目变成了一个资源有限的项目,因为有人不顾一切地想把一个解决方案卖给客户。结果是预算紧张,特性被剔除,SDLC过程被削减到最低。这些短线是采取这样的公司有一些机会盈利,甚至打破平衡。

    这是我看到的与一个资源有限的项目同时进行的事情的列表:

    • 分配给QA的最短时间
    • 不规范工作的严格的官僚程序
    • 变更请求预算可能很小或不存在
    • 形式化的过程被放弃,转而使用开发时间。
    • 没有时间进行像QA那样的内容检查(例如文本中的语法或拼写错误)。
    • 无法为客户端执行任何内容管理或数据输入
    • 必须选择“足够好”的编码解决方案
    • 走廊可用性测试没有时间限制。
    • 没有编写用户文档或手册的预算。
    • 编码前一般没有时间进行技术研究
    • 没有时间生成风险分析文档
    • 可以使用生产检查表而不是项目进度表。
    • 对于程序员来说,现在没有时间在项目进度表中填写他们的“实际”时间与“估计”时间。
    • 向客户提供的进度更新可能不太频繁或非常基本
    • 可用于了解客户机业务域的时间更少
    • 程序员可能不得不无偿加班。
    • 没有为项目死后分配时间

    对于一个资源有限的项目,还有什么其他确定的迹象?

    = =

    编辑

    我将尝试用一个例子来澄清一些混乱。这就是我的意思:给客户一个建议/报价,说他们的项目将花费2万美元,然后客户回来说:“对不起,我的预算是最多16万美元。”老板说“提议1.6万美元——我们要这个工作”。

    因此,有效地说,你必须用比它应该拥有的更少的预算来做一个项目。有些界限让它变得荒谬——如果客户说“我的预算是4千美元”,那么你就不可能做到。

    是的,有时紧缩的预算会变得如此愚蠢,以至于在一开始就接受项目(即注定要失败的项目)是一个糟糕的商业决策。

    我知道没有一个项目的预算是无限的。通常,业务人员决定是否应该执行项目(业务人员通常不是项目经理)。

    7 回复  |  直到 15 年前
        1
  •  5
  •   BIBD    15 年前

    你所说的不是一个“有限资源”的项目,而是一个匆忙的、计划外的项目。

    我对您列表中的一些项目有异议:

    • 不规范工作的严格的官僚程序
    • 变更请求预算可能很小或不存在

    实际上,这些应该是大多数项目的标准。您或客户,谁要求并支付变更费用?

    • 无法为客户端执行任何内容管理或数据输入
    • 没有编写用户文档或手册的预算。

    如果这不是合同的一部分,你为什么要这样做?

    • 必须选择“足够好”的编码解决方案

    在某个时刻,你必须停在“足够好”的位置,否则你将从现在开始打磨,直到时间结束。

    我将添加到您的列表中的内容包括:

    • 办公用品变得稀缺,或者被锁上了钥匙。
    • 公司提供的食品/饮料消失
    • 停机时间消失。你的时间表上100%的时间必须致力于项目工作。
    • 打印机/复印机正在打印其他员工的简历。
    • 老板的门一天关了90%。
        2
  •  2
  •   ChrisLively    15 年前

    坦白地说,我从来没有听说过一个拥有无限资源的项目。即使是政府也会在一段时间后停止某些事情。

    因此,从纯逻辑的角度来看,所有项目的资源都是有限的。

        3
  •  1
  •   Robert Munteanu    15 年前

    资源有限?我所知道的所有项目都资源有限:

    • 时间
    • 开发人员
    • 预算
        4
  •  1
  •   Darth Continent    15 年前

    过时的或明显的beta文档,它与产品在现场发布的任何版本都不相冲突,或者看起来像是经过几代Xerox拷贝的文档。

    无现场安装或支持。根据正在实现的系统的大小,一个状态良好的公司可能会派出一个或多个开发人员来监督实现,而一个关系紧张的公司可能只会以一种更“放火而忘”的方式提供电话或电子邮件支持。

        5
  •  1
  •   Cătălin Pitiș    15 年前
    • 不断出现新的, 被遗忘的特征,假设为 用户“明显”和“含蓄”, 要求中从未说明, 导致讨论错误与变更 请求。
    • 采用瀑布模型代替 迭代方法。
    • 客户抗议 修好,说:“如果 你有虫子,是因为你 你的工作做得不好“,不是 接受三重约束 切割时对质量的影响 时间/预算。
    • 降低价格的压力 维护和支持活动 项目部署后 生产。
    • 采用固定价格项目(外包)转移金融风险和时间线风险的压力。
        6
  •  1
  •   Kwang Mark Eleven    15 年前

    “低价项目”

    如果我正确理解您的意思,那么您实际上是在谈论项目,项目的可用资源不适合实现向客户承诺的结果。

    我可以想出四种方法来解决这种情况:

    1. 编制项目计划时估计错误
    2. 要求蠕变
    3. 在不缩小项目范围的情况下减少项目预算
    4. 项目范围内的资源(员工技能、计算机资源等)不足

    当项目中的人员意识到这种情况时,他们实际上有两种选择:削减成本或缩小范围。削减范围可能是一种艰难的销售,可能危及项目的可行性,因此大多数时候人们选择削减客户,尤其是因为成本可以通过多种方式削减,而不会引起更高层的注意:

    • 无偿加班
    • 降低质量
    • 删除文档

    诸如此类。

    事实上,当你开始削减成本的时候,你甚至可以看起来像一个优秀的项目经理,因为成本控制是项目经理的职责之一!我假设你想找到诊断资金不足项目的方法。我认为,我将努力确定一个一般的情况,而不是制定一个广泛的症状清单。

    在我看来,有一个通用的条件可以确定一个资金不足的项目。对于大多数项目,员工是最大的成本——或者至少是项目经理可以管理的第二大成本。每当你发现一位经验丰富的经理采取措施降低员工成本,而这些措施并不是最初计划的一部分,那么你就可以确定你有一个资金不足的项目。

    当做,

        7
  •  0
  •   louism    14 年前

    利用你们所提供的信息,我可以把它们拼凑起来写一篇文章。

    我在这里放置一个链接,以防将来有人寻求有关该主题的帮助:

    Surviving An Under-resourced Project

    ——LM